Brief summary

This study has its objectives: To evaluate the safety and tolerability of multiple oral doses of NPI-001 Tablets in healthy adult subjects; To evaluate the effect of food on the pharmacokinetics (PK) of NPI-001 following single doses, 1500 mg and 750 mg, in the fed versus fasted state; To characterize the pharmacokinetics of NPI-001 following multiple doses over 5 days, fed; To evaluate the effect of NPI-001 on potential biomarkers of the pharmacodynamic effect (protein carbonyls, GSH/GSSG, cysteine/cystine (Cys/Cys-Cys)). Study design: This randomized, double-blinded, cross-over study will include an evaluation of PK of NPI-001 in fed versus fasted healthy volunteers followed by a 5-day dosing period to ascertain if multiple doses of NPI-001 can alter GSH and CYS levels in plasma. Potential subjects will be screened to assess their eligibility to enter the study within 28 days prior to first dose administration. Subjects will be resident in the clinical facility from the evening prior to first dose (Day -1) until discharge on Day 10. A post-dose follow up visit will occur at Day 15. On Day 1 and Day 3, each subject will receive a single oral dose of NPI-001 or Placebo. The dose levels of NPI-001 will be 1500 mg for Cohort 1 (6 tablets), and 750 mg for Cohort 2 (3 tablets). Dosing on Days 1 and 3 will be a placebo-controlled, balanced, two-treatment two-sequence randomized fasted/fed crossover design, as follows: • 8 subjects in each cohort (6 NPI-001, 2 placebo) will be dosed on Day 1 following a 10 hour overnight fast and on Day 3 following a high fat breakfast [Fasted-Fed]. • 8 subjects in each cohort (6 NPI-001, 2 placebo) will be dosed on Day 1 following a high fat breakfast and on Day 3 following a 10 hour overnight fast [Fed-Fasted]. On Days 5-9, all subjects will receive NPI-001 or placebo three times per day, at approximately 8am (following a standard breakfast), 2pm and 8pm, with the last dose on the morning of Day 9. The dose levels of NPI-001 will be 500 mg per dose for Cohort 1 (2 tablets), and 250 mg per dose for Cohort 2 (1 tablet). Safety measures monitored throughout the study will include adverse events and use of concomitant medication, vital signs, and clinical laboratory tests. Blood samples for assessment of PK will be collected on Days 1, 3 and 9, at pre-dose, then at 0.25, 0.5, 1, 1.25, 1.5, 1.75, 2, 2.5, 3, 4, 6, 8, 10 and 12 hours post-dose, and on Days 2, 4 and 10 at 24 hours post-dose. Blood samples for assessment of PD will be collected on Days 1 and 3 at pre-dose and 1 hour post-dose, on Day 9 at 1 hour post-dose, and at the follow-up visit.

The high fat breakfast will consist of: 2 eggs fried in butter, 2 strips bacon. 2 slices of toast with butter, 4 oz hash brown potatoes fried in butter 8 oz (240 mL) whole milk. This high fat meal contains the equivalent of approximately 150 protein calories, 250 carbohydrate calories, and 500 to 600 fat calories. For the high fat meal, subjects should commence the recommended meal approximately 30 minutes prior to administration of the study drug. Although study subjects should consume this meal in less than or equal to 30 minutes, the drug product should be administered approximately 30 minutes after starting the meal and at least 80% of the meal should be finished promptly. The following measures will be employed to ensure treatment and high fat meal compliance: All study drug doses and high fat meals will be administered under the supervision of suitably qualified study site staff Immediately after dose administration, visual inspection of the mouth and hands will be performed for each subject At each dosing occasion, a predose and postdose inventory of IMP and placebo will be performed on the dose containers. Subjects will be monitored throughout the trial for adherence to the protocol by CMAX staff. All deviations from the protocol will be recorded by staff on duty at the time and logged in the eCRF for the study. Inclusion criteria

Subjects must satisfy all of the following criteria at the Screening Visit unless otherwise stated: 1. Males or females, of any race, between 18 and 60 years of age, inclusive. 2. Body mass index between 18.0 and 32.0 kg/m2, inclusive. 3. In good health, determined by no clinically significant findings from medical history, physical examination, 12-lead ECG, vital sign measurements, and clinical laboratory evaluations at Screening or Check-in as assessed by the Investigator (or designee). 4. Females will be nonpregnant and nonlactating, and females of childbearing potential and males will agree to use contraception. 5. Able to comprehend and willing to sign an informed consent form (ICF) and to abide by the study restrictions.

Exclusion criteria

Subjects will be excluded from the study if they satisfy any of the following criteria at the Screening visit, unless otherwise stated: 1. Significant history or clinical manifestation of any metabolic, allergic, dermatological, hepatic, renal, hematological, pulmonary, cardiovascular, gastrointestinal, neurological, respiratory, endocrine, or psychiatric disorder, as determined by the Investigator (or designee). 2. History of significant hypersensitivity to any drug compound, food, or other substance, unless approved by the Investigator (or designee). 3. History of stomach or intestinal surgery or resection that would potentially alter absorption and/or excretion of orally administered drugs, including cholecystectomy (uncomplicated appendectomy and hernia repair will be allowed). 4. History of alcohol abuse or drug/chemical abuse per the Diagnostic and Statistical Manual of Mental Disorders-IV criteria within 2 years prior to Check in. 5. Alcohol consumption of >21 units per week for males and >14 units for females. 6. Positive urinary drug screen (confirmed by repeat, if necessary) at Screening (does not include alcohol) or Check in (does include alcohol breath test). 7. Liver function test values >1.5 upper limit of normal (ULN) (excluding isolated hyperbilirubinemia) or QTcF >450 milliseconds. 8. Positive hepatitis panel and/or positive human immunodeficiency test. Subjects whose results are compatible with prior immunization and not infection may be included at the discretion of the Investigator. 9. Participation in a clinical study involving administration of an investigational drug (new chemical entity) in the past 30 days or 5 half lives, whichever is longer, prior to Check in. 10. Use or intend to use any medications/products known to alter drug absorption, metabolism, or elimination processes, including St. John’s Wort, within 30 days or 5 half-lives (whichever is longer) prior to Check in, unless deemed acceptable by the Investigator (or designee). 11. Use or intend to use any prescription medications/products other than oral, implantable, transdermal, injectable, or intrauterine contraceptives, or hormone replacement therapy, within 14 days prior to Check in, unless deemed acceptable by the Investigator (or designee). 12. Use or intend to use any nonprescription medications/products (excluding paracetamol, which is allowed), vitamins, minerals, antioxidant supplements (e.g., acetylecysteine-related, cysteine-related or glutathione-related substances, etc.) and phytotherapeutic/herbal/plant derived preparations within 7 days prior to Check in, unless deemed acceptable by the Investigator (or designee). 13. Use of tobacco or nicotine containing products within 3 months prior to Check in and positive urine cotinine test at screening or check-in. 14. Receipt of blood products within 2 months prior to Check in. 15. Donation of blood from 30 days prior to Screening, plasma from 2 weeks prior to Screening, or platelets from 6 weeks prior to Screening. 16. Poor peripheral venous access. 17. Have previously completed or withdrawn from this study or any other study investigating NPI 001 or NACA, and have previously received the investigational product. 18. Subjects who, in the opinion of the Investigator and/or Sponsor (or designee), should not participate in this study. 19. An employee of the sponsor or research site personnel directly affiliated with this study or their immediate family members defined as a spouse, parent, sibling, or child, whether biological or legally adopted.
